Summer Youth Training and Outdoor Skills Building Program
From July 6 through Aug. 30, Goodwill, in partnership with Seattle Parks and Recreation and Center for Career Alternatives (CCA), is offering a summer program for 30 teens ages 15 to 17 in the community.
In the morning at Goodwill, students learn retail and customer service skills to prepare them for jobs; conflict resolution skills; training in cultural awareness; environmental stewardship; how to apply to college; and other important skills.
They work with Seattle Parks and Recreation staff in the afternoons to restore trails, cull invasive plants and work on park stewardship projects to earn service learning hours required for high school graduation. CCA provides case management support.
